What is Carboxymethyl Cellulose?<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-c2764a4 elementor-widget elementor-widget-text-editor\" data-id=\"c2764a4\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Carboxymethyl Cellulose (CMC) is a water-soluble, anionic cellulose derivative renowned for its thickening, stabilizing, and moisture-retention properties. Sourced from renewable cellulose, this versatile polymer modifies rheology, enhances texture, and improves shelf-life across industries. Carboxymethyl Cellulose\u2019s unique functionality stems from its adjustable molecular structure, making grade selection fundamental to success.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-8324727 elementor-widget elementor-widget-heading\" data-id=\"8324727\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">II. Understanding Carboxymethyl Cellulose Grading<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-4503354 elementor-widget elementor-widget-heading\" data-id=\"4503354\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">1. Two key parameters affecting Carboxymethyl Cellulose Grading<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-e920a03 elementor-widget elementor-widget-heading\" data-id=\"e920a03\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\">1). Degree of Substitution (DS):<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-257418b elementor-widget elementor-widget-text-editor\" data-id=\"257418b\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\tThis measures the average number of carboxymethyl groups attached per anhydroglucose unit in the cellulose chain.\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-f229fd7 elementor-widget elementor-widget-heading\" data-id=\"f229fd7\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h5 class=\"elementor-heading-title elementor-size-default\">Impact<\/h5>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-3b381d4 elementor-widget elementor-widget-text-editor\" data-id=\"3b381d4\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>DS significantly affects solubility, salt tolerance, and sensitivity to pH. Higher DS generally means better solubility in cold water and higher tolerance to electrolytes (salts), making it suitable for demanding environments like detergents or oil drilling fluids. Lower DS grades might gel or precipitate in high-salt solutions.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-630c766 elementor-widget elementor-widget-heading\" data-id=\"630c766\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\">2). Viscosity (Solution Concentration):<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-7fd06e4 elementor-widget elementor-widget-text-editor\" data-id=\"7fd06e4\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\tThis is the most common way to distinguish CMC powder grades. Reported as the viscosity of a specific concentration solution (e.g., 1% or 2%) measured under standardized conditions. Grades range from Low Viscosity (LV) to Medium Viscosity (MV), High Viscosity (HV), and Extra High Viscosity (XHV).\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-4896f8a elementor-widget elementor-widget-heading\" data-id=\"4896f8a\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h5 class=\"elementor-heading-title elementor-size-default\">Impact<\/h5>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-1938405 elementor-widget elementor-widget-text-editor\" data-id=\"1938405\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\tViscosity directly relates to the thickening, binding, water retention, and suspension capabilities of the Carboxymethyl Cellulose. Higher viscosity grades provide greater thickening power at lower concentrations but might be harder to disperse.\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-11f5728 elementor-widget elementor-widget-heading\" data-id=\"11f5728\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">2. Different Viscosity Grades of Carboxymethyl Cellulose<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-e391d84 elementor-widget elementor-widget-image\" data-id=\"e391d84\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"image.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<img decoding=\"async\" src=\"https:\/\/tenessy.com\/wp-content\/uploads\/elementor\/thumbs\/HPMC\u6eb6\u6db2-1-r04r0f1kcmxwdlcjfudd91m388kjhxlnx6grn05ngi.webp\" title=\"\u6eb6\u6db2\" alt=\"solution\" loading=\"lazy\" \/>\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-7d9698e elementor-widget elementor-widget-heading\" data-id=\"7d9698e\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\">1.Low Viscosity Carboxymethyl Cellulose<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-290fd28 elementor-widget elementor-widget-text-editor\" data-id=\"290fd28\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Viscosity Range<\/b>: 25-100 centipoise viscosity at 2% concentration in water (25\u00b0C).<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-f1ca734 elementor-widget elementor-widget-text-editor\" data-id=\"f1ca734\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Characteristics<\/b>: \u00a0LV CMC offers good water binding, suspension stabilization for light particles, and film-forming properties without significantly increasing viscosity.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-2f6379e elementor-widget elementor-widget-text-editor\" data-id=\"2f6379e\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Typical Applications<\/b>: Manufacturers use Low Viscosity CMC in applications requiring clarity, low body, or easy pumping, such as light-duty detergents, low-viscosity adhesives, paper coatings requiring penetration, and as a stabilizer in some beverages or dairy products like flavored milk.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-63fe537 elementor-widget elementor-widget-heading\" data-id=\"63fe537\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\">2.Medium Viscosity Carboxymethyl Cellulose<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-4c79a47 elementor-widget elementor-widget-text-editor\" data-id=\"4c79a47\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Viscosity Range<\/b>: 400-1000 centipoise viscosity at 2% concentration in water (25\u00b0C).<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-47611e3 elementor-widget elementor-widget-text-editor\" data-id=\"47611e3\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Characteristics<\/b>: MV CMC provides moderate thickening, good water retention, effective suspension of medium-weight particles, and stable rheology.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-d85c33a elementor-widget elementor-widget-text-editor\" data-id=\"d85c33a\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Typical Applications<\/b>: This grade serves widely as a thickener, binder, and stabilizer in products like latex paints, wallpaper pastes, tablet binders and disintegrants in pharmaceuticals, textile printing thickeners, and mid-range viscosity food items such as sauces and syrups.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-ec6906e elementor-widget elementor-widget-heading\" data-id=\"ec6906e\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\">3.High Viscosity Carboxymethyl Cellulose<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-882e7f7 elementor-widget elementor-widget-text-editor\" data-id=\"882e7f7\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Viscosity Range<\/b>: 1500-2500 centipoise viscosity<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-d8ad977 elementor-widget elementor-widget-text-editor\" data-id=\"d8ad977\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Characteristics<\/b>: HV CMC provides excellent water retention, suspension for heavier particles, and high film strength.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-a6bde3e elementor-widget elementor-widget-text-editor\" data-id=\"a6bde3e\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Typical Applications<\/b>: Industries utilize High Viscosity CMC where significant thickening or body is essential, such as in high-viscosity drilling muds, toothpastes, thick creams and lotions, high-solids adhesives, ceramic glazes, and as a thickener in desserts or pie fillings.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-a0f565b elementor-widget elementor-widget-heading\" data-id=\"a0f565b\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\">4.Extra High Viscosity Carboxymethyl Cellulose<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-1580e86 elementor-widget elementor-widget-text-editor\" data-id=\"1580e86\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Viscosity Range<\/b>: exceeding 3,000 centipoise, often reaching 5,000 centipoise or higher at 2% concentration in water (25\u00b0C).<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-fce50ed elementor-widget elementor-widget-text-editor\" data-id=\"fce50ed\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Characteristics<\/b>: XHV CMC offers exceptional water binding, extreme suspension capabilities, and very high film strength.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-5f70cf6 elementor-widget elementor-widget-text-editor\" data-id=\"5f70cf6\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><b>Typical Applications<\/b>: Applications demanding maximum viscosity, gel strength, or water retention utilize Extra High Viscosity CMC, including specialized oil well fracturing fluids, extremely high-viscosity adhesives and sealants, and heavy-duty paper coatings.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div Food &amp; Beverage:<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-feb34ab elementor-widget elementor-widget-text-editor\" data-id=\"feb34ab\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Manufacturers require high-purity CMC, typically demanding FCC-grade certification. They need precise viscosity control to achieve desired textures in products like sauces and ice cream, along with excellent clarity.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-97a7c91 elementor-widget elementor-widget-image\" data-id=\"97a7c91\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"image.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<img decoding=\"async\" src=\"https:\/\/tenessy.com\/wp-content\/uploads\/elementor\/thumbs\/Baked_Goods_11zon-r60r7drc2p90g4mf2f17t2s2uelw0cn7fsewvqav42.webp\" title=\"Baked_Goods\" alt=\"Baked_Goods\" loading=\"lazy\" \/>\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-2d18b10 elementor-widget elementor-widget-heading\" data-id=\"2d18b10\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\"><a href=\"https:\/\/tenessy.com\/applications\/pharmaceuticals\/\">2).Pharmaceuticals:<\/a><\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-b37e5cc elementor-widget elementor-widget-text-editor\" data-id=\"b37e5cc\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>This sector mandates extremely high purity, meeting USP\/NF or EP pharmacopeial standards. Formulators rely on controlled viscosity for functions like tablet binding or suspension stabilization and require specific dissolution profiles. Biocompatibility is absolute essential.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-f98628c elementor-widget elementor-widget-heading\" data-id=\"f98628c\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\">3).Oil &amp; Gas Drilling Fluids:<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-ef36443 elementor-widget elementor-widget-text-editor\" data-id=\"ef36443\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Applications demand CMC with a high degree of substitution to ensure tolerance to salt and calcium ions. Engineers specify particular viscosity grades for effective fluid loss control and lubrication.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-6044556 elementor-widget elementor-widget-heading\" data-id=\"6044556\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\"><a href=\"https:\/\/tenessy.com\/applications\/daily-chemical-solution\/\">4).Detergents &amp; Cleaners:<\/a><\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-f57832f elementor-widget elementor-widget-text-editor\" data-id=\"f57832f\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Formulators frequently utilize low to medium viscosity CMC grades. These grades provide effective anti-redeposition of soils and soil suspension capabilities, requiring good electrolyte tolerance achieved through a high degree of substitution.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-edd0b2f elementor-widget elementor-widget-heading\" data-id=\"edd0b2f\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\">5).Paper, Textiles, Ceramics, Paints:<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-bcdebb4 elementor-widget elementor-widget-text-editor\" data-id=\"bcdebb4\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Viscosity requirements vary considerably within these industries, such as between coating applications and internal sizing in papermaking. Purity standards depend on the specific end-use, while strong water retention properties are frequently a key requirement.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-3bbb9ad elementor-widget elementor-widget-heading\" data-id=\"3bbb9ad\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h4 class=\"elementor-heading-title elementor-size-default\">6).Personal Care &amp; Cosmetics:<\/h4>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-72f715e elementor-widget elementor-widget-text-editor\" data-id=\"72f715e\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Product developers need specific viscosity grades to formulate lotions and shampoos effectively, alongside high-purity CMC. They often prioritize clarity in transparent products, and achieving the desired skin feel is crucial for consumer acceptance.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-1a74116 elementor-widget elementor-widget-image\" data-id=\"1a74116\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"image.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<img decoding=\"async\" src=\"https:\/\/tenessy.com\/wp-content\/uploads\/elementor\/thumbs\/personal_care-r6sw2dxjg2cs4i2nq92ms9jejj3jt18uywn0788ohu.webp\" title=\"personal_care\" alt=\"personal_care\" loading=\"lazy\" \/>\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-461c641 elementor-widget elementor-widget-heading\" data-id=\"461c641\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">3.Purity Requirements:<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-ebeda7b elementor-widget elementor-widget-text-editor\" data-id=\"ebeda7b\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><em><b>Food<\/b>:<\/em>Must meet Food Chemical Codex (FCC) standards, ensuring low levels of impurities.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-dae6dd3 elementor-widget elementor-widget-text-editor\" data-id=\"dae6dd3\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><em><b>Pharma<\/b>:<\/em>Requires United States Pharmacopeia (USP), National Formulary (NF), or European Pharmacopoeia (EP) compliance, demanding stringent purity and testing.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-7119360 elementor-widget elementor-widget-text-editor\" data-id=\"7119360\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li><em><b>Industrial<\/b>:<\/em>Technical grades are available with lower purity, often at a reduced cost.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-fe9124a elementor-widget elementor-widget-heading\" data-id=\"fe9124a\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">4.Particle Size &amp; Dispersion:<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-ed0d78c elementor-widget elementor-widget-text-editor\" data-id=\"ed0d78c\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<ul><li>Finer CMC powder disperses and hydrates faster but can be dusty. Coarser grades disperse slower but are easier to handle. Choose based on your mixing equipment and process time.<\/li><\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-f11bebc elementor-widget elementor-widget-heading\" data-id=\"f11bebc\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">IV. Contact our technical experts today for personalized recommendations and samples!<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-07e6ebe elementor-widget elementor-widget-heading\" data-id=\"07e6ebe\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">FAQ<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-9eb3844 elementor-widget elementor-widget-elementskit-faq\" data-id=\"9eb3844\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;ekit_we_effect_on&quot;:&quot;none&quot;}\" data-widget_type=\"elementskit-faq.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<div class=\"ekit-wid-con\" >\n                <div class=\"elementskit-single-faq elementor-repeater-item-0ce007d\">\n            <div class=\"elementskit-faq-header\">\n                <h2 class=\"elementskit-faq-title\"> Why is purity grade important for Carboxymethyl Cellulose?<\/h2>\n            <\/div>\n            <div class=\"elementskit-faq-body\">\n                Purity is critical for safety and performance. Food\/pharma require FCC, USP, or EP grades ensuring non-toxicity. Industrial uses like drilling fluids may accept lower purity. Always match the grade to your industry's regulatory and safety standards.            <\/div>\n        <\/div>\n                <div class=\"elementskit-single-faq elementor-repeater-item-5966179\">\n            <div class=\"elementskit-faq-header\">\n                <h2 class=\"elementskit-faq-title\">Can I use the same CMC grade for different applications?<\/h2>\n            <\/div>\n            <div class=\"elementskit-faq-body\">\n                While sometimes possible, it's inefficient. Viscosity, purity, DS, and particle size requirements differ drastically between food, pharma, oilfield, and detergents. Using an incorrect grade risks product failure or higher costs. Optimize per application.            <\/div>\n        <\/div>\n                <div class=\"elementskit-single-faq elementor-repeater-item-1b6afa9\">\n            <div class=\"elementskit-faq-header\">\n                <h2 class=\"elementskit-faq-title\">My CMC solution isn&#039;t dissolving properly. What could be wrong?<\/h2>\n            <\/div>\n            <div class=\"elementskit-faq-body\">\n                Common issues include: using cold water (use warm), insufficient agitation, poor powder dispersion (sprinkle slowly), low DS grade (less soluble), or incompatible water hardness\/ions. Ensure correct mixing protocol and grade selection for your conditions.            <\/div>\n        <\/div>\n                                <script type=\"application\/ld+json\">{\"@context\":\"https:\/\/schema.org\",\"@type\":\"FAQPage\",\"mainEntity\":[{\"@type\":\"Question\",\"name\":\" Why is purity grade important for Carboxymethyl Cellulose?\",\"acceptedAnswer\":{\"@type\":\"Answer\",\"text\":\"Purity is critical for safety and performance.
